C.N.A. opportunity in beautiful Montana!!
Bitterroot Health is seeking candidates to fill a C.N.A. position. A certified nursing assistant provides assistance to the professional nursing staff providing care to patients with various acuity across the age spectrum. Provides for activities of daily living by assisting with serving meals, feeding patients as necessary and ambulating, turning, and positioning patients. Maintains patient stability by checking vital signs, weight, blood glucose and records intake and output information. Collaborates with ancillary staff and communicates with care team and co-workers regarding patient condition. Participates in quality and performance improvement projects.
Minimum Qualifications:
  • Education: High School graduate or equivalent preferred
  • Licensure and Certifications: Current CNA license per State of Montana Regulations with certification in good standing without disciplinary action or investigation. Basic Life Support (BLS).
  • Job Knowledge/Skills/Abilities: Computer Skills/EMR experience preferred.

Schedule: Full time, 36 hours/week, Variable Shifts
